33. Did anyone read the story? NOT 16 "today"...
Edited on Tue Nov-09-04 04:41 PM by chiburb
On edit, snip added:
A total of 16 Americans have been killed in the past two days across Iraq - including three killed in Fallujah combat on Tuesday, two killed by mortars near the northern city of Mosul and 11 others who died Monday, most of them as guerrillas launched a wave of attacks in Baghdad and southwest of Fallujah.

The 11 deaths were the highest one-day U.S. toll in more than six months.





I don't mean to pick nits here, and I'm in total agreement with most of the posts here. That said:

The actual headline does NOT say 'today'. The story says 11 killed yesterday. Can't we try to keep LBN a place for sharing NEWS? I mean, the OP would be fine for GD... but shouldn't LBN stay "accurate"?
